Job description: Business Analyst –Energy & Utilities
Job Summary
The Business Analyst – Energy &Utilities; is responsible for analyzing business processes, gatheringrequirements, and supporting digital transformation initiatives within the energyand utilities sector (electricity, gas, water, renewables). This role bridgesbusiness needs and technology solutions to improve efficiency, compliance, andcustomer experience.
Key Responsibilities
- RequirementsGathering
- Work with stakeholders to understand businessneeds and objectives
- Document functional and non-functionalrequirements
- BusinessProcess Analysis
- Analyze existing utility processes (billing,metering, asset management, grid operations)
- Identify gaps, inefficiencies, and improvementopportunities
- DataAnalysis & Reporting
- Analyze operational and customer data togenerate insights
- Prepare dashboards, reports, and KPIs
- SolutionDesign Support
- Collaborate with IT teams to design systemenhancements or current solutions
- Support implementation of enterprise systems(e.g., SAP IS-U, Oracle Utilities)
- Regulatory& Compliance Support
- Ensure solutions align with energy marketregulations and compliance requirements
- StakeholderManagement
- Communicate clearly with business users, projectteams, and vendors
- Facilitate workshops and requirement sessions
- Testing& Implementation
- Support UAT (User Acceptance Testing)
- Validate system functionality against businessrequirements
